WorkflowLogo AssessmentHero

Online OOP & Design Patterns Test – Einstellungstest zur Bewerbervorauswahl

Ingenieurwesen
10 Min.
OOP & Design Patterns online testMobile OOP & Design Patterns skill assessment

Worum geht es in dem Test?

Dieser Test bewertet das Wissen und Verständnis der Kandidaten über objektorientierte Programmierung (OOP) und Design Patterns. Er hilft Ihnen dabei, Personen zu identifizieren, die sich gut mit den Prinzipien der OOP und Design Patterns in der Anwendungs- und Webentwicklung auskennen.

Abgedeckte Fähigkeiten

Verständnis der OOP-Prinzipien
Anwendung von Design Patterns
Problem lösen
Software Design

Testersteller

Test creator
Jonas Schmutte
Full Stack Entwickler bei Libri
Jonas Schmutte, ein versierter Full Stack Entwickler, ist derzeit bei der Libri GmbH tätig. Mit einem Bachelor- und einem Master-Abschluss in Informatik von der Universität Bremen ist er in den Bereichen Maschinelles Lernen, Künstliche Intelligenz, Mensch-Technik-Interaktion und Softwareentwicklung hervorragend ausgebildet. Jonas hat seine beruflichen Fähigkeiten als Softwareentwickler bei Bijou Brigitte und als Datenanalyst-Praktikant bei Seghorn AG weiterentwickelt. Seine berufliche Erfahrung umfasst Schlüsselbereiche wie die Entwicklung und Wartung von Kassensystemen, Datenanalyse und maschinelle Lernsysteme. Mit seinen ausgeprägten analytischen Fähigkeiten und seinem Talent für technische Problemlösungen ist Jonas eine Kombination aus akademischer Exzellenz und beruflicher Robustheit.

Wer sollte diesen Test machen?

.NET-Entwickler, Android-Entwickler, ASP.NET (Core) MVC-Entwickler, ASP.NET Web Forms-Entwickler, Back-End-Entwickler, C#-Entwickler, C++-Entwickler, Full-Stack-Entwickler, Go-Entwickler, iOS-Entwickler, Java-Entwickler, JavaScript-Entwickler, Laravel-Entwickler, PHP-Entwickler, Python-Entwickler, React-Entwickler, Ruby-Entwickler, Ruby on Rails-Entwickler, Salesforce-Entwickler, Scala-Entwickler, Softwareentwickler, Spring Framework-Entwickler, SQL-Entwickler, TypeScript-Entwickler, VB.NET-Entwickler, Vue.js-Entwickler, Webentwickler, Web-Front-End-Entwickler, WordPress-Entwickler

Beschreibung

Objektorientierte Programmierung (OOP) ist ein grundlegendes Programmierparadigma, das in verschiedenen Sprachen wie Java, C++, und Python verwendet wird. Design Patterns sind wiederverwendbare Lösungen für häufig auftretende Probleme im Software-Design. Ein Entwickler, der sowohl mit OOP als auch mit Design Pattern vertraut ist, kann effizient komplexe Softwareentwicklungsprobleme lösen und robusten, skalierbaren und wiederverwendbaren Code produzieren.

Dieser Test bewertet das Verständnis der Kandidaten und die praktische Kenntnis der Schlüsselkonzepte der OOP wie Vererbung, Polymorphie, Kapselung und Abstraktion. Er bewertet auch die Vertrautheit mit häufig verwendeten Design Patterns wie Singleton, Factory, Observer und Strategy und deren Fähigkeit, diese Patterns in realen Szenarien anzuwenden.

Kandidaten, die in diesem Test hervorragend abschneiden, werden starke Fähigkeiten im Problemlösen und im Entwerfen vielseitiger Software-Systeme demonstrieren. Sie werden wertvolle Vermögen für Ihr Anwendungs- und Webentwicklungsteam sein.

Überblick

Ingenieurwesen
10 Min.
Verständnis der OOP-Prinzipien
Anwendung von Design Patterns
Problem lösen
Software Design

Testersteller

Test creator
Jonas Schmutte
Full Stack Entwickler bei Libri
Jonas Schmutte, ein versierter Full Stack Entwickler, ist derzeit bei der Libri GmbH tätig. Mit einem Bachelor- und einem Master-Abschluss in Informatik von der Universität Bremen ist er in den Bereichen Maschinelles Lernen, Künstliche Intelligenz, Mensch-Technik-Interaktion und Softwareentwicklung hervorragend ausgebildet. Jonas hat seine beruflichen Fähigkeiten als Softwareentwickler bei Bijou Brigitte und als Datenanalyst-Praktikant bei Seghorn AG weiterentwickelt. Seine berufliche Erfahrung umfasst Schlüsselbereiche wie die Entwicklung und Wartung von Kassensystemen, Datenanalyse und maschinelle Lernsysteme. Mit seinen ausgeprägten analytischen Fähigkeiten und seinem Talent für technische Problemlösungen ist Jonas eine Kombination aus akademischer Exzellenz und beruflicher Robustheit.